NFC coming soon, thanks BIBD

Written by Rano Iskandar on . Posted in technology, bank, Business, Social News

 

"
Hjh Nurul Akmar Hj Md Jaafar, Head of Retail Banking, BIBD, showcasing a sneak peek of BIBD NEXGEN Wallet (NFC) which will kick off in January 2019
 

As part of BIBD’s efforts to support the de-cashing of the economy (meaning less reliance on real cash in hand), BIBD has already introduced digital conveniences such as BIBD Quickypay for QR code payments (introduced a few months ago), BIBD vCard or Virtual MasterCard, its MasterCard Contactless and Visa payWave under its BIBD NEXGEN platform.

There is still room for growth in this department and BIBD will soon up their game by using NFC (Near Field Communication) where all you need is tapping your smartphone only. This is quite common in the US and UK and even in China. This is where BIBD will come in as a pioneer by introducing BIBD NEXGEN Wallet.

This will be made possible once their next BIBD app version will be available in January 2019. It will be synced from the user’s debit or virtual cards to the NEXGEN Wallet which means you don’t have to fork out your debit cards and simply tap your smartphone on the payment terminal.

Hjh Nurul Akmar Hj Md Jaafar, Head of Retail Banking, BIBD, said that all the customers have to do is place or tap your smartphone on the terminal and it will automatically open the BIBD app and it will prompt you for a pin number. After being verified, the transaction will be complete. The cool thing about the BIBD NEXGEN Wallet is that it can function without internet, for purchases up to BND 100.

This is something many will be looking forward to and furthermore, BIBD is well prepared as most of their existing merchants have card terminals which are able to receive NFC payment. Awesome!! The only thing is that the NFC service will only be available for Android users. As for IOS users (Apple), BIBD will be in talks with Apple in hoping that NFC can be readied for BIBD users on IOS.

This is the way of the future indeed and I hope the traction will be higher once NFC become available in Brunei and thank you to BIBD for pioneering this technological move.

BIBD introduces cashless payment

Written by Rano Iskandar on . Posted in bank, lifestyle, Business, Social News

 

 

"
Yang Berhormat Dato Seri Setia Awang Abdul Mutalib, Minister of Communications visiting BIBD Pavilion and launching the new products from BIBD, BIBD BizNet and QuickPay at the TechXpo 2018 yesterday
 

First it was the eTunai (back in 2013) and now BIBD has upped their game by re-inventing the wheel, launching a better version, BIBD’s QuickPay. All you need is a QR Code and a BIBD app to settle a transaction. Easy peasy. The great thing about the QuickPay is that you won’t need physical terminals to carry out the transaction. The current eTunai which will be phased out, requires a presence of the tablet and there are currently 50 vendors using eTunai in Brunei Darussalam.

I believe BIBD’s move to introduce the QuickPay is to make payment more seamless especially among Small Medium Enterprises (SMEs) in Brunei Darussalam and even start-ups. The other advantage is that they don’t have to invest in the cash register of point-of-sale machines to complete the transaction.

It was mentioned from a BIBD representative that they QuickPay will have a lower cost transaction than the current ones with terminal points. The other great thing is that BIBD has also launched its BIBD MSME Account which requires a minimum opening and average monthly balance of only BND 50. Now ain’t that great news?

I’m not sure which vendors have already utilized the QuickPay mechanism but before that, you will need to update to BIBD’s app version (3.8.0) so you can use QuickPay.

The other product launched by BIBD is BIBD BizNet banking platform app provides corporate customers along with government-linked companies in Brunei Darussalam mobile access to the BIBD BizNet web-based platform.

Launched earlier this year, BIBD BizNet is an upgrade to its previous digital Corporate Internet Banking platform that provides day-to-day accounts and payments operations support with real-time account access along with a collection of other enhanced features.

These include single security token access for Parent and Subsidiary accounts, payment approval, fund transfers and bill payments along with information such as foreign currency rates and branch/ATM locator and other services.

Both BIBD BizNet and BIBD’s QuickPay were launched by Yang Berhormat Dato Seri Setia Awang Abdul Mutalib, Minister of Communications at the TechXpo 2018 at International Convention Centre yesterday.

Both products are testament for the BIBD NEXGEN initiative. I just hope one day will see NFC in form of payment where all you need to do is tap with your phone to make a transaction. Local banks help financing RB’s latest fleet

Written by Rano Iskandar on . Posted in Business, Social News

 


ang Berhormat Dato Seri Paduka Dr. Awang Hj Mohd Amin Liew Abdullah, the Minister of Finance II, as the guest of honour (2nd from left), Mr. Mubashar Khokar, Managing Director of BIBD, Mr. Karam Chand, the CEO of Royal Brunei Airlines (RB) and Mr. Pierre Imho, the CEO of Baiduri Bank
 


Guest of honour delivering his welcoming remarks at Brunei International Airport

Royal Brunei Airlines (RB) has closed the Islamic financing of one Boeing 787-8 aircraft and five Airbus A320neo and the conventional financing of two Airbus A320neo at a signing ceremony held at Brunei International Airport.

It was interesting to know that two local banks are involved in the financing where the islamic financing is under BIBD’s portfolio while the conventional term loan is under Baiduri Bank’s portfolio.

Present at the event was Yang Berhormat Dato Seri Paduka Dr. Awang Hj Mohd Amin Liew Abdullah, the Minister of Finance II, as the guest of honour. Signing on behalf of RB was Mr. Karam Chand, the CEO of RB whole Mr. Mubashar Khokar, Managing Director of BIBD and Mr. Pierre Imho, the CEO of Baiduri Bank signed on behalf of BIBD and Baiduri Bank respectively.

“The combination of conventional financing for 2 aircrafts with an islamic financing structure for 6 other aircrafts allowed Royal Brunei Airlines to achieve attractive terms. The new fleet allows RB to achieve a leaner cost structure from the combination of lower ownership and maintenance costs and lower fuel burn. Complete fleet renewal is a rarity in our industry and to achieve this by the end of 2018 will be a very significant milestone for RB,” said Karam Chand.

“Alhamdullilah, I would like to congratulate RB on another national milestone with the latest additions to their fleet, and also becoming our latest “Partner in Growth”. Together may we continue to support Brunei Darussalam’s economic diversification while strengthening Brunei’s positioning as a regional hub for economic activity and trade. The acquisition of these aircrafts is also another landmark transaction for Brunei’s Islamic banking and financial industry in general as it highlights our local capabilities to deliver on large complex Islamic transactions,” said Mr. Mubashar Khokar.

“Baiduri Bank is proud to enter into this partnership with RB, where we will be financing two unites of Airbus A320neo aircrafts. As a major local bank with a strong commitment to the Brunei market, Baiduri will continue to play an active role in providing financing to businesses, contributing to the economic growth of the country and its development programmes in order to meet the goal of Brunei’s Wawasan 2035,” said Mr. Pierre Imhof.

Progresif Pay is out

Written by Rano Iskandar on . Posted in gadget, lifestyle, Social News

 


Click image to enter website to learn more
 


Yang Berhormat Abdul Mutalib bin Pehin Orang Kaya Seri Setia Dato Paduka Haji Mohd Yusof, Minister of Communications, launched Progresif Pay last week at Rizqun International Hotel. Progressive Pay is brought to you by Progresif and powered by BIBD NEXGEN.
 

Other countries have implemented it. I know China is known for their WeChat. Today, it is made possible by Progresif powered by BIBD NEXGEN known as Progresif Pay. It is definitely a stepping stone in terms of cashless payments in Brunei Darussalam.

It was launched by Minister of Communications Yang Berhormat Abdul Mutalib bin Pehin Orang Kaya Seri Setia Dato Paduka Haji Mohd Yusof who applauded both Progresif and BIBD for the collaboration in pursuing to be a smart nation in this era of digital economy. The minister shared that Brunei Darussalam is ranked 53rd in the world in the ICT development index.

Also accompany the Minister were Mubashar Khokhar, Managing Director and CEO of BIBD and Paul Taylor, Chief Executive Officer of Progresif who both had inspiring quotes from Henry Ford and Michael Jordan respectively. Mubashar re-quoted, “Coming together is the beginning. Keeping together is progress. Working together is success” while Paul mentioned, “Individuals win games while teamwork wins championships”.

Powered by BIBD NEXGEN, Progresif PAY creates an alliance between Brunei’s most innovative mobile operator and the country’s best digital bank at the forefront of branchless banking and mobile commerce by improving access and creating opportunities for greater commercial efficiency, diversification and development of Brunei’s digital economy.

Now what can be useful when you use Progresif Pay? A few things. You don’t need to bring a thick wallet, or even better a wallet. You don’t need a bank account to begin with to. You will still need to be a Progresif subscriber to be eligible for Progresif Pay.

Having said all that, first thing’s first – download the app, both available on IOS and Google Play. You will need to pop down to a Progresif Store or BIBD Branch for identity verification and registration. Then you will get your own virtual card (just like a virtual debit card). The maximum value that you can put into the virtual account will be BND 3,000 and the great thing about it is that your Progresif Pay virtual card is not tied to any of your bank accounts or credit cards. In other words, it’s safe and secured.

Once you have activated your Progresif Pay, you can pay your bills such as utilities or make donations. You can send money to other Progresif Pay users. You can even use your Progresif Pay to shop online, just like a credit card. Since you are a Progresif user, you can even top up to add data or minutes through Progresif Pay. Awesome!!

Marketing strategy will be a key component in helping others to adopt to the newly introduced Progresif Pay, according to Devin Edwards, Chief Marketing Officer of Progresif Pay. He envisioned that their neighbours at the popular Gadong wet market will make use of Progresif Pay among the vendors so it will be totally convenient and cashless.

It will be interesting to see the adoption rate of Progresif Pay because once they are many Progresif Pay users, it have a domino effect as users will find it very convenient in making transactions.
